BOD Sensor
Many organic substances dissolved in water absorb ultraviolet light. Therefore, the total amount of organic pollutants in water can be measured by measuring the absorption of these organic substances by ultraviolet light at a wavelength of 254nm. BOD5001 series use two light sources, one 254nm ultraviolet and one 850nm infrared light, which can automatically compensate the optical path attenuation and turbidity effects, thus achieving more stable and reliable measurement values.
